India, Jan. 4 -- In exercise of the powers conferred under Section 163 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ita-2023 (BNSS) read with the relevant provisions of the NDPS Act, 1985, Dr. Rakesh Minhas, District Magistrate Jammu has ordered that no courier company, parcel service, or logistics operator functioning within the district Jammu shall accept, book or transport any narcotic drugs, psychotropic substances, or other contraband items unless it holds a valid transport permit under NDPS Rules 1985 and as per regulations under Drugs and Cosmetic Act 1940.
